Starting Over
At one time my life seemed better than I could ever dream. Fate then decided to pay me a call It designed a very clever scheme, that brought me to my knees, that wasn't all. All at once I looked around, and found so much was gone Something that couldn't possibly be true. My life ended, yet I continued to live on. In utter bewilderment, I struggled to know what to do. Nothing was left, my future appeared to be gone too. But I had to quickly set something in motion. I had to regroup, and sadly start life anew But how to do it with lack of any emotion? But I did, little by little, I moved along from what was my original place. Trying to find a way to belong, and to fit into a brand new space. The process has been slow, the years have come and gone. I make mistakes, I sometimes go the wrong way. I try to memorize the right words as I would a song, And learn life's roles as if they were acts from a play. But what I now know, though it has taken awhile. Time that I did not want or need to loose Was to live my own ideal of what is a lifestyle, and to be true to myself however and whatever I choose.
